Greetings everyone,

I’m Bije from Indonesia. I’d like to ask for advice regarding my plan to visit Japan in January–February 2025. However, I’m still confused about which transportation option is the best and most cost-effective, especially considering the significant price increase of the JR Pass.

I will be traveling with my wife and my 1.5-year-old child. We will arrive at Haneda on January 28, 2025, and return to Indonesia from Haneda on February 5, 2025. I plan to visit Osaka, Kyoto, Fuji, and Tokyo, with the following detailed itinerary:

Itinerary – Japan Trip 2025

January 28, 2025
• Direct to Osaka. January 29, 2025
• Osaka sightseeing (Osaka Castle, Kuromon, Dotonbori). • Transport: Public transportation. January 30, 2025
• Shinkansen to Kyoto. • Kyoto sightseeing (Arashiyama, Fushimi Inari Taisha, Kiyomizudera, Gion). • Hotel check-in. • Transport: Public transportation. January 31, 2025
• Kyoto to Shirakawago. • Explore Shirakawago. • Shirakawago to Takayama. • Hotel check-in. • Transport: Private bus. February 1, 2025
• Explore Takayama Old Town. • Takayama to Tokyo. • Hotel check-in. • Transport: Private bus. February 2, 2025
• Tokyo sightseeing (Harajuku, Shibuya, Asakusa). • Transport: Public transportation. February 3, 2025
• Tokyo sightseeing (Tsukiji Fish Market, Akihabara). • Free time. • Transport: Public transportation. February 4, 2025
• Tokyo Disneyland. February 5, 2025
• Heading back to Indonesia.

With this itinerary, which option should I choose?
• JR Pass Nationwide 7 days • Hokuriku Arch Pass 7 days • Single tickets for each trip, and buy Osaka Day Pass, Kyoto Day Pass, and Tokyo Day Pass

I’d really appreciate the advice of anyone familiar with this, as I’ve been quite stressed about deciding which option is the best and most budget-friendly.

Hi there,

Travel to Takayama and Shirakawa-go would not be covered by the Hokuriku Arch Pass, and even though travel to Takayama would be covered with a regular 7-day JR Pass, it's price is too high to justify purchasing it for your itinerary if you're seeking the most cost-effective option. I'd therefore recommend purchasing your tickets individually.
